Transaction 364f349f9ab020988a8213318bd5108298b905843fd408cb78450e2848490bd7

2 Input
2 Outputs
  • 364f349f9ab020988a8213318bd5108298b905843fd408cb78450e2848490bd7:0
  • value  72497312
    address  1B6UuGudU3GFqAtpWBi5WV1xPkTMFCRfZz
  • 364f349f9ab020988a8213318bd5108298b905843fd408cb78450e2848490bd7:1
  • value  1600000000
    address  3MJ6D5PnpCMis1xXhgeFuqyES6QPZmBHbA